str8baller Posted March 6 Posted March 6 13 hours ago, Uspshoosier said: A common refrain from coaches is that they feel in previous roster builds, money has been spread around too widely. They’d prefer, starting this year, to spend big on two to three top-tier players and fill in around them with cheaper role players with more defined roles. In NBA terms, those are your max contracts, a few middle-market players and then a bench filled out with minimum contracts. That’s something I pointed out last spring. I’m not sure why it’s taking college guys so long to catch on. All you had to do was look at other pro leagues. I suspect this is something a guy like Carr will have a good handle on. Popular Post Demo Posted March 6 Popular Post Posted March 6 Punting work today and hitting the Missouri Valley Conference qtrs. The friend I’m going with and knows way more about that conference than I do, gave me 3 names to watch for portal purposes: 1) Sam Orme(Belmont)- Carmel kid who’s busted out this year pretty good. Averaging 13 and 5 on 38% from 3. 2 years of eligibility. Given the 2 ‘26 kids, Dorn and, presumably, Sisley can’t imagine a 6’7” wing shooter would be a high priority, but who knows. 2) Jaquan Johnson(Bradley)- averaged 17 and was 1st team all conference and 1st team all defense. Averaged more steals than to’s. 2 years of eligibility. Since Norton was there he feels like at least worth checking into. 3) Drew Scharmowski(Belmont)- The one I really want to see. 6’10” and apparently possibly still growing. Averaged 11/6 with a block and a steal in 19mins a game and was 1st team all conference and 1st team all defense. 2 years of eligibility. My friend loves him. Says he’s a straight up winning player. At minimum, anyone coached by Casey Alexander absolutely knows how to play. That guy is as good a developmental coach as there is. Should be fun.
